You know that sinking feeling when you realize you've been ignoring great advice or giving up on something that actually worked? We've all been there, myself included. That's why I loved this conversation with Matt Nettleton. As my most frequent podcast guest, Matt brought his signature blend of insight and candor to our “What Went Wrong?” series. Together, we revisited the missteps that taught us valuable lessons—like ditching a successful accountability group, setting goals that feel more like a prison sentence than a roadmap, and stubbornly resisting good advice. If you've ever tripped over your own decisions, this one's for you. Actionable Takeaways Stick With What Works: If a process, group, or habit is driving success, don't abandon it just because things are going smoothly. Consistency beats complacency. Shrink Your Timeframe: Break those massive annual goals into manageable chunks. Try a “12-week year” approach to stay motivated, track progress, and pivot as needed. Listen to Advice (Even When It's Hard): Pay attention to the advice of trusted colleagues and mentors—and maybe your spouse, too. The sooner you act on good suggestions, the faster you'll see results. Celebrate and Course-Correct: Mark your milestones, reassess your direction, and give yourself permission to change the plan if it's no longer serving you. Costco is in the news this week for increasing their employee pay to over $30 per hour. We talk about what this means for Costco's brand, and why they consistently pay higher than any of their competitors. This episode is sponsored by Prime Payments USA.
